我过去使用 gphoto 捕获图像并将它们直接下载到我的计算机,而不是使用相机中的 sd 卡。我想知道是否可以对视频执行此操作,或者在成功录制后将文件视频文件复制到计算机。我正在寻找--capture-image-and-download
与命令行中的数码单反相机等效的视频/电影或其他程序
1 回答
取决于您的数码单反相机,但有可能,请参阅此处的命令行(“电影捕捉”): http: //gphoto.org/doc/remote/
编辑 :
目前可以通过以下方式捕捉有声电影:
较新的尼康数码单反相机:gphoto2 --set-config movie=1 --wait-event=10s --set-config movie=0 --wait-event-and-download=2s。用你想让你的电影长的秒数替换 10s。这在 2012 年左右开始支持,大约在 D7000 版本左右。
较新的佳能 EOS 数码单反相机(约 7D 及更高版本):将相机切换到相机上的电影录制模式。然后运行 gphoto2 --set-config viewfinder=1 --set-config movierecordtarget=Card --wait-event=10s --set-config movierecordtarget=None --wait-event-and-download=2s(2.5.6之前, 用 eosviewfinder 替换取景器)。如果这不起作用,请检查并将 capturetarget 切换到 SD 卡 (gphoto2 --set-config capturetarget=1)
具有预览捕捉能力的旧相机: gphoto2 --capture-movie=10s 。这将捕获 10 秒的预览帧并将它们连接到 MotionJPEG 样式流中。
对于佳能,您需要将 --set-config movierecordtarget=Card 更改为 --set-config movierecordtarget=0 并将 --set-config movierecordtarget=None 更改为 --set-config movierecordtarget=1。